Md. Code Ann., Elec. Law § 12-105
Bond requirements for recount petition or counterpetition
Effective Jan 1, 2003Added as Art. 33, § 12-105, by Acts 1998, c. 585, § 2, eff. Jan. 1, 1999. Transferred to Election Law § 12-105 by Acts 2002, c. 291, § 2, eff. Jan. 1, 2003. Amended by Acts 2002, c. 291, § 4, eff. Jan. 1, 2003.State of Maryland
- (a) A petition or counterpetition filed under this subtitle shall be filed with a bond as provided under subsection (b) of this section.
(b)
- (1) If a recount is being conducted in only one county, a judge of the circuit court of the county shall determine and set the bond to be filed by the petitioner or counterpetitioner sufficient to pay the reasonable costs of the recount.
- (2) If the recount is being conducted in more than one county, a judge of the Circuit Court for Anne Arundel County shall determine and set the bond.
